a crowbar having the lenght of 1.75 is used to balance a load of 500N if the distance between the fulcrum and the load is 0.5m f

ind the effort applied to balance the load​

The effort applied = 200 N

<h3>Further explanation</h3>

Equilibrium :

\tt F_1.d_1=F_2.d_2

Total length = 1.75

The distance between the fulcrum and the load is 0.5 m ⇒ d₁=0.5 m

The distance between the fulcrum and the force applied :

\tt 1.75-0.5=1.25~m\rightarrow d_2=1.25~m

A load of 500N ⇒ F₁=500 N

The force applied :

\tt 500\times 0.5=F_2\times 1.25\\\\F_2=\dfrac{500\times 0.5}{1.25}=200~N
